This week, Kanye West and adidas dropped the fourth colorway of the YZY QNTM, a silhouette that appeared for the first time at last year’s NBA All-Star Weekend in Chicago, where it was handed over to Kanye’s Blade Runner-esque armoured tank followers. This Saturday , October 10, the YZY QNTM “Teal Blue” finally brings its icy touch to the line after weeks of teasers.
A digi-camo print covers much of the Primeknit upper of the sneaker, with contrasting accents in the centerpiece aqua blue, a break from the normal grayscale of the QNTM line. The sneaker is completed by reflective detailing at the heel and a suede overlay at the toe. The YZY QNTM “Teal Blue” benefits from a full-length Boost midsole on the technical material, while a bungee cord lacing device holds it in place safely.
